Could not find CS4231A (version=00)

Remember that this chip (and the ethernet controller) are on the same bus as the IDE controller. There have been a few cases where it's just a matter of checking & fixing the bus and everything comes back.

A touch more complicated than fixing the IDE header, but not a disaster. It is a job for someone comfortable/compentent with surface mount soldering, but likely not something only the big guns can fix.
